Bioaccumulation: aquatic/sediment

The bioaccumulation study was conducted in fish for estimating the BCF bioaccumulation factor) value of test chemical Dipotassium 4,4'-bis[6 -anilino-4 -[bis(2 -hydroxyethyl) amino-1,3,5 -triazin-2 -yl]amino]stilbene-2,2'-disulphonate (CAS no. 71230 -67 -6). The BCF value was calculatedusing a SRC-BCFWIN v2.15, program and a log Kow of 0.65. The BCF (bioaccumulation factor) value of Dipotassium 4,4'-bis[6 -anilino-4 -[bis(2 -hydroxyethyl)amino-1,3,5 -triazin-2 -yl]amino]stilbene-2,2'-disulphonate was estimated to be 3.162 dimensionless, which does not exceed the bioconcentration threshold of 2000, indicating that the chemical Dipotassium 4,4'-bis[6 -anilino-4 -[bis(2 -hydroxyethyl)amino-1,3,5 -triazin-2 -yl]amino]stilbene-2,2'-disulphonate is considered to be non-accumulative in aquatic organisms.

Bioaccumulation: aquatic/sediment

Experimental study for the target compound Dipotassium 4,4'-bis[6-anilino-4-[bis(2-hydroxyethyl)amino-1,3,5-triazin-2-yl]amino]stilbene-2,2'-disulphonate (CAS No. 71230-67-6) and various supporting weight of evidence studies for its read across substance were reviewed for the bioaccumulation end point which are summarized as below:

 

In an experimental weight of evidence study from secondary source (OECD SIDS, 2005) and authoritative database (INERIS, 2009) for the target chemical Dipotassium 4,4'-bis[6-anilino-4-[bis(2-hydroxyethyl)amino-1,3,5-triazin-2-yl]amino]stilbene-2,2'-disulphonate (CAS No. 71230-67-6), bioaccumulation experiment was conducted in fish for estimating the BCF bioaccumulation factor) value of test chemical Dipotassium 4,4'-bis[6 -anilino-4 -[bis(2 -hydroxyethyl) amino-1,3,5 -triazin-2 -yl]amino]stilbene-2,2'-disulphonate. The BCF value was calculated using a SRC-BCFWIN v2.15, program and a log Kow of 0.65. The BCF (bioaccumulation factor) value of Dipotassium 4,4'-bis[6 -anilino-4 -[bis(2 -hydroxyethyl)amino-1,3,5 -triazin-2 -yl]amino]stilbene-2,2'-disulphonate was estimated to be 3.162 dimensionless.

 

For the read across chemical disodium 2,2'-ethene-1,2-diylbis{5-[(4-anilino-6-morpholin-4-yl-1,3,5-triazin-2-yl)amino]benzenesulfonate} (CAS no. 16090-02-1) from authoritative databases (J-CHECK, HSDB, 2017 and EnviChem, 2014),bioaccumulation study was conducted on test organism Cyprinus carpio for 6 weeks for evaluating the bioconcentration factor (BCF value) of read across substance disodium 2,2'-ethene-1,2-diylbis{5-[(4-anilino-6-morpholin-4-yl-1,3,5-triazin-2-yl)amino]benzenesulfonate}. The study was performed according to other guideline "Bioaccumulation test of a chemical substance in fish or shellfish" provided in "the Notice on the Test Method Concerning New Chemical Substances”. Cyprinus carpio was used as a test organism for the study. Details on analytical methods involve the recovery ratio: Test water: 1st concentration area : 94.6%, 2nd concentration area : 91.3%, Fish: 85.9%, - Limit of quantitation: Fish : 0.093 ppm. Test chemical nominal conc. used for the study were 0.2 mg/land 0.02 mg/l, respectively. Dimethyl sulfoxide was used as a vehicle in the study. Range finding study involve the TLm (48 hr) ≥ 50 ppm (w/v) on Rice fish (Oryzias latipes).The bioconcentration factor (BCF value) of substance disodium 2,2'-ethene-1,2-diylbis{5-[(4-anilino-6-morpholin-4-yl-1,3,5-triazin-2-yl)amino]benzenesulfonate} on Cyprinus carpio was determined to be in the range of 1.4 – 4.7 L/Kg at a conc. of 0.2 mg/l and ≤ 6.4 – 28 L/Kg at a conc. of 0.02 mg/l, respectively.

 

In a supporting weight of evidence study from authoritative database (HSDB, 2017) for the read across chemical Benzenesulfonic acid,2,2'-(1,2-ethenediyl)bis[5-[[4-[(2-hydroxyethyl)methylamino]-6-(phenylamino)-1,3,5-triazin-2-yl]amino]-,sodium salt (1:2) (CAS no.13863-31-5), bioaccumulation experiment was conducted for determining the BCF (bioaccumulation factor) value of read across chemical Benzenesulfonic acid,2,2'-(1,2 -ethenediyl)bis[5 -[[4 -[(2 -hydroxyethyl)methylamino]-6 -(phenylamino)-1,3,5 -triazin-2 -yl]amino]-,sodium salt (1:2). The BCF (bioaccumulation factor) value of Benzenesulfonic acid,2,2'-(1,2 -ethenediyl)bis[5 -[[4 -[(2 -hydroxyethyl)methylamino]-6 -(phenylamino)-1,3,5 -triazin-2 -yl]amino]-,sodium salt (1:2) was determined to be < 2.1 dimensionless.

 

On the basis of above results for target chemical Dipotassium 4,4'-bis[6-anilino-4-[bis(2-hydroxyethyl)amino-1,3,5-triazin-2-yl]amino]stilbene-2,2'-disulphonate (from secondary source) and for its read across substance (from authoritative databases J-CHECK, HSDB, 2017 and EnviChem, 2014), it can be concluded that the BCF value of test substance Dipotassium 4,4'-bis[6-anilino-4-[bis(2-hydroxyethyl)amino-1,3,5-triazin-2-yl]amino]stilbene-2,2'-disulphonate was estimated to be 3.162 which does not exceed the bioconcentration threshold of 2000, indicating that the chemicalDipotassium 4,4'-bis[6-anilino-4-[bis(2-hydroxyethyl)amino-1,3,5-triazin-2-yl]amino]stilbene-2,2'-disulphonateis not expected to bioaccumulate in the food chain.
